How many permutations are there in the letters of the word FROZEN?

Answer explanation

There are 6 different letters, so the permutation is solved using nPn=6!. 6!=6x5x4x3x2x1=720

In how many ways can four men and three women arrange themselves in a row for picture taking if the men and women must stand in alternate positions?

(Take note that the number of men and women is not the same)

Answer explanation

4x3x3x2x2x1x1
